Untitled is a 1997 ink by Louis Silverstein, held at Museum of Modern Art.
This print is mostly black with sharp white shapes. One corner has thick diagonal lines, another has a grid of tiny dots, and a thin white stripe cuts across the middle. The edges look uneven, like the shapes are slightly off-kilter. The title isn’t given, but the artist’s name is signed in the corner. It’s part of a set of 40 prints made in 1997.
